15 years have passed by since Dennis Bergkamp scored *that* goal against Newcastle at St James' Park.
As lovely as the goal was, we've decided against writing a gushing 3,000-word piece about how its sheer beauty made us cry tears of joy, and have instead used it as an excuse to churn out a Bergkamp-related quiz.
During his time with Arsenal, the Dutchman scored against 49 different teams in both domestic and European competition. You've got 5 minutes to name as many of those teams as you possibly can.
To make things a little bit easier, we've included the country from which the teams he scored against in European competition originate from.
